Despite the heavy overhauling that Take-Two Interactive will be subjecting themselves to until the end of fiscal year 2008, Rockstar Games' Grand Theft Auto IV (for the P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360) has still been reaffirmed for release by October as previously announced. The company announced their lineup of games for the Q3 and Q4 of their 2007 fiscal year, after reporting a US$ 60 million dip in sales for their Q2.

Troublesome news also ran amok that Take-Two Interactive is seeing lay-offs due to its announced "restructuring program," designed to make the company financially disciplined in game development - a partial reaction to the company's stock options controversy sparked last year.

According to GTA4.net, however, none of the restructuring should affect GTA IV and its succeeding episodes as they have been officially listed in the company's release lineup for their respective periods. That, however, comes with some disappointing news. A question raised at the company's recent conference call pinned a no-go for a PS2 version of the game.

Other developments taken from the conference include non-identical versions between the P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360 versions, despite claims that there are no platform preferences used in developing the game. News about the two additional episodes with more gameplay hours and content, both of which have been slated for release by 2008, have also stemmed from the conference.
